Meaning of
sanzeedagi
संज़ीदगी • سنجیدگی
English
seriousness; gravity
Hindi
गंभीरता; गम्भीरता
Urdu
سنجیدگی; وقار
Origin
Persian

Nuance
Sanzeedagi evokes a sense of depth and gravity, often associated with a thoughtful demeanor. In poetry, it transcends mere seriousness, embodying a profound engagement with life's complexities.
Poetic Usage
Poets use sanzeedagi to convey a character's depth or the gravity of a situation. It contrasts with light-heartedness, often highlighting the weight of emotions or decisions.
